Quote #10

"No matter what you did, the diaspora mothers with pumping breasts would impugn your character. And an African woman, with a single glance from eyes that had burned away their own lashes, could discredit your elements." (10.180)

Although there's nothing wrong with Jade's self-esteem, she does have moments of doubt. She can feel that black people around her judge her for acting "white." She fears these people's judgment because deep down she does think that there's something inauthentic about her.
